> A first round of PRs were tested on Luminous integration branch, results
> updated at http://tracker.ceph.com/issues/21830,
> RADOS suite was green, RBD, RGW & FS hit some known failures
>
> ceph-disk has hit a failure with dmcrypt, details at
> http://tracker.ceph.com/issues/21830#note-10 which doesn't seem to have
> occured in QE runs before but there is a bug report, is anyone aware of
> past issues with ceph-disk & dmcrypt?
>
> Also for the leads, Sage, Yehuda. Jason, Josh, Patrick are there any
> critical PRs that we need to have in 12.2.2 so that we can include
> them in the next round of testing before handing over to QE?
